Twelve prominent linguists and linguistic anthropologists examine 'responsibility', 'authority', and 'knowledge', all central, but problematic concepts in contemporary anthropology. Their detailed case studies analyse diverse forms of oral discourse ñ from everyday conversation and conversational narrative to divination and ritual poetry ñ in the Americas, Africa, Asia, and the Pacific.
